Dive into the rich world of classical chamber music with Jiří Bárta's captivating album, "Moscheles & Hummel: Cello Sonatas." Released in 2006 under the prestigious Hyperion label, this album is a testament to Bárta's virtuosity and his deep connection with the music of Ignaz Moscheles and Johann Nepomuk Hummel.
The album features a stunning collection of cello sonatas, including Moscheles' Cello Sonata in E Major, Op. 121, and Hummel's Cello Sonata in A Major, Op. 104. Each piece is performed with exquisite precision and a profound understanding of the composers' intentions, making this album a standout in the genre of classical chamber music.
Bárta's performance is complemented by the masterful piano accompaniment of Hamish Milne, creating a harmonious blend that brings these historic works to life. The album also includes a selection of Melodisch-contrapunktische Studien, Op. 137b, showcasing Bárta's versatility and technical prowess.
